About DOE Boost

DOE Boost, powered by Sandia National Laboratories, in partnership with FedTech, is a unique startup studio program designed to:

  • Identify breakthrough energy technologies developed within DOE laboratories.
  • Pair these technologies with visionary entrepreneurs and innovators.
  • Guide teams through a structured program to develop viable commercialization strategies.

Why This Matters Now

The U.S. energy sector faces urgent challenges:

  • Growing demand driven by electrification, AI, and advanced manufacturing.
  • Increasing threats to energy infrastructure from natural hazards and cyberattacks.
  • Global competition for critical materials and resources.

DOE Boost directly addresses these challenges by accelerating the translation of publicly funded research into real-world impact, supporting both local communities and national security.
